Director of Market Operations (Power Business)

Xpansiv®, a trailblazer in the energy and environmental commodities market, operates the integrated, open, and neutral market platform designed to accelerate the global energy transition.  Xpansiv provides thousands of market participants and intermediaries with access to the widest possible range of energy transition markets, through its suite of solutions, including the world’s largest environmental commodities trading platform, where billions of assets cross per year. Xpansiv’s end-to-end technology platform services the entire life cycle of environmental commodities, connecting diverse markets and market participants across the world and enabling stakeholders to deliver transparent and trusted environmental claims to address the growing demand for energy transition. Leveraging its extensive industry knowledge and proven technology portfolio, Xpansiv assists companies seeking to identify and mitigate risk, streamline the management of their environmental assets, and comply with regulations, caps and commitments.


Position Summary:

The Director of Market Operations is responsible for both long-term planning for APX’s Helpdesk Operations and overseeing the daily operations of the helpdesk team, ensuring APX’s platform and customers operational activities are supported efficiently and effectively. This role requires a strong technical background in grid operations, exceptional leadership skills, and the ability to manage customer relationships and service level agreements (SLAs). As a key member of the Power Solutions Team, the Director will define team goals, create and augment operations processes, and resolve problems to support Xpansiv’s growing portfolio of diverse wholesale power market clients.  

Additionally, the Director will work closely with clients and the APX Product and Clients Service teams to help drive geographic expansion of services and support across ISOs. This will include activities such as researching ISO requirements, developing and overseeing operator training, and helping to define feature requirements.  


What you’ll do:
  • Lead and supervise the APX 24x7 Operations team to support client participation in wholesale electricity markets across all North American ISOs 
  • Develop, coordinate and drive the operations plans and establish/update procedures for maintaininghigh standards of operations to ensure that services and processes conform to established customer and company standards 
  • Set and clarify requirements and expectations for direct reports based on the strategic direction and needs of the business 
  • Develop and implement training programs to ensure that the team is equipped with the necessary skills and knowledge 
  • Provide oversight, guidance, and mentorship for operations team 
  • Oversee and lead the development of requirements, documentation and readiness of real-time personnel, processes and technologies required to successfully integrate changes associated with ISO changes, new client requirements, and service/geographic expansion (e.g.., new services in PJM, SPP, etc) 
  • Respond and provide input to inquiries from outside agencies including NERC and FERC 
  • Define required strategies, technology solutions, and organizational structures to meet company, customer and market expectations proactively 
  • Develop and deliver operations protocols for clear and concise communications both up, down, and sideways across the organization 
  • Maintain strong relationships with key stakeholders, including customers, vendors, and internal teams 
  • Provides subject matter expertise and an operations perspective to Power Solutions Product and Client Services teams in the development and formulation of long and short-range strategic planning, policies, programs, and objectives 
  • Communicate effectively with customers to understand their needs and provide timely updates on issue resolution 
  • Attend industry/business meetings to understand ISO and customer changes and requirements to develop "best practices" policies and procedures 
  • Work closely with Human Resources to lead the team with integrity and to establish and maintain a trusting, inclusive, and productive environment that promotes employee wellbeing, engagement & quality of life 


What you’ll bring:
  • A Bachelor's degree (BA, BS) or equivalent education, training or experience in Engineering (power system operations and/or electric generation operations), Economics, or related discipline 
  • 8+ years of experience in North American electric power sector 
  • Knowledge of regulatory requirements and industry standards related to grid operations 
  • Minimum of 3 years of experience in a grid operations or technical support role 
  • Minimum of 5 years in a people management role 


Desired Qualifications:
  • Experience with PJM market operations and regulations 
  • Deep understanding or working knowledge of demand response, energy storage, or VPP (Virtual Power Plant) operations 
  • Experience with SCADA (Supervisory Control and Data Acquisition) systems

Base Salary

Compensation for this role will vary among specific regions due to geographic differentials in the labor market, actual pay will be determined considering factors such as relevant skills and experience, knowledge, education and training. However, compensation in the Tier 1 & Tier 2 regions is expected to be as follows:

Tier 1: $170,000-$190,000

Tier 2: $160,000 -$180,000
